RTKlib/постпроцессинг

-1

Дизассемблинг с помощью IDA. Уж больно x86 отличается идеологией, мозги уже не те. Хочется на пальцах - работа с регистрами, операции пересылки в памяти, арифметика, плавающая арифметика, работа с IO. Создавать ничего не собираюсь, только понять как работает ARM. Ну и хорошо бы базовые вещи - после reset происходит то-то и то-то, загружается код с такого-то адреса… Разницу ARM/Thumb слегка представляю, но как работает совмещенный режим ? Это функция для ОС или для процессора ? Базовые вещи интересуют, for dummies.

-1

-1

Тамб-2 хорошо описан у Joseph Yiu.
Одна проблема: ближайший бумажный вариант - на амазоне…

По памяти: сечас gpsd в сети лежит неполный (каких-то файлов не хватает).
Если у Вас есть полный архив gpsd - пожалуйста обнародуйте любым доступным образом.

Буду ждать.

-1

Сбросил два файла:
Скачать 101_1044.JPG
Скачать GPS-MS-05007RUS.pdf
В первом фотография EM-500 в корпусе.
Во втором описание Antaris. На странице 79 указаны, входные mgs RTCM - 1,2,3,9, и сравните с данными на стр.27 пост 658- 18,19,22,3 в SOURCETABLE первая строка, содержания. RTKNAVI поддерживает RTCM mgs 18,19.

-1

-1

Железяка (EM-500 + FT232RL + Taoglas AA.161) в тепличных условиях заработала.
Буду разбираться с софтом…

Антенна лежит на перилах балкона, западное полушарие неба - практически чистое и ни чем не закрыто, восток - перекрыт домом. Картинка со спутниками этому полностью соответствует.

А можно фотку все этого железного безобразия ?

Пожалуйте:

На фото - Navilock EM-500 и LVTTL2USB со встроенным стабилизатором. Индикатор состояния GPS и держатель для литиевой батарейки (для памяти настроек) пока не приделал.
Антенна (Taoglas AA.161) в кадре отсутствует.

Писал письмо в областное управление кадастра и картографии они меня обрадовали, по плану в 13-14 годах в Поволжье должны быть развернуты в работоспособном состоянии диф. станции с публичным доступом к данным. А сейчас здания есть, а аппаратуры еще нет :frowning: Вообще это единственный ОГВ кто на письмо ответил за 4 дня, а не месяц тянут кота за хвост как им позволяет законодательство да и ответ меня удовлетворил больше чем я спрашивал. Надо куда нить благодарственное письмо на них написать :slight_smile:
Вообщем надо озаботится сбором аналогичной штуки к сроку :slight_smile: По чём всё это удовольствие вышло ?

Тут скорее вопрос не в цене, а в расходах на доставку и организационных моментах.
EM-500 были любезно предоставлены usm78-gis безвозмездно, но стоят они меньше 10 Евро, если не путаю), пигтейлы для антенн у меня были, lvttl2usb с питанием - по 11 баксов (это, строго говоря, программатор для микроконтроллеров) в комплекте с кучей гребёнок и длинным USB-кабелем - брал у JKdevices, плюс антенны по 25 баксов с DigiKey. На конвертерах сэкономить можно, слепив самостоятельно схему на FT232RL.

Он же и сам по себе субметровую точность грозиться выдавать. С постобработкой это может быть дециметровая?

-1

-1

Запустить rtknavi удалось, правда, на балконе прием довольно поганый, надо сказать.
Но последовательность действий отлажена и можно пробовать на природе.

Возник вопрос: как описывать в конфиге для rtknavi некоторые команды?
Например, я хочу вписать туда команду включения сообщений RXM-RAW.
В бинарном виде она выглядит так:

B5 62 06 01 06 00 02 10 01 01 01 01 23 DB

где
B5 62 - заголовок “UBX”
06 01 - идентификатор сообщения “CFG-MSG”
06 00 - идентификатор сообщения “CFG-PRT” длина содержимого сообщения
02 10 - идентификатор сообщения “RXM-RAW”
01 01 01 01 - маска портов USART0…2, USB “включить на всех”
23 DB - контрольная сумма

В доке по rtklib написано, что поддерживается отправка CFG-MSG таком виде:

!UBX CFG-MSG msgid rate0 rate1 rate2 rate3

Я правильно понимаю, что приведенное выше сообщение в формате для rtknavi будет выглядеть как:

!UBX CFG-MSG 02 10 01 01 01 01 

? или msgid нужно писать в каком-то ином формате?